2013年4月14日 星期日

Hello World! 用 Corona SDK 實作


話說回到西元 1997 年,網際網路上的網站數量那時候第一次超過百萬個。哇100萬耶,真是個不可思議的數字,Google、Facebook、Wikipedia 這些著名網站也還沒出生哩,人們想像不到十幾年後的今天,網站數會有 5 億個之多。所以今天我們聽見有 70 多萬的 Android 應用程式、100 萬的 iOS 應用程式也不用奇怪,要知道,劃時代的行動紀元才剛剛要開始。你準備好當一個『行動應用開發者』了嗎?趕快來學 Corona SDK 吧!

來吧,先到 Corona 網站註冊一個會員,

http://www.coronalabs.com/ 點選右上角的 Sign-in ,選好自己的登入 e-mail 跟密碼,在 Terms and Conditions of Use. 打個勾,按 continue 就行了。



然後下載一個 Corona SDK 就可以開始了。

https://developer.coronalabs.com/downloads/corona-sdk ,這裡要選好自己的環境,也就是看你是用 Mac OS or Windows PC,請選擇你要用的下載就好。

PS:我因為使用的是 Mac OS 的電腦,所以往後的例子我都以 Mac 環境為主,你若遇到問題可以到社團裡問我。

好了,當你下載好了 Corona SDK,並在你的電腦把它解壓縮,並放到你的應用程式群組裡面後,你就可以開始創作你的行動應用程式了。

不能免俗的,我們來看看如何在行動裝置上做一個 Hello World! 的程式吧。

我們先打開 CoronaSDK/SampleCode/GettingStarted/HelloWorld 資料夾

你會看到夾子裡有三個重要的檔案,他們是 build.settings / config.lua / main.lua



Corona SDK 的世界裡面,一個 project 專案,就是一個檔案夾 folder,檔案夾裡只要有這三個檔案,它就可以執行。例如:我們現在如果要執行這個 HelloWorld 的專案,我們只要先執行 Corona Simulator 的模擬器環境,接下來選 Simulator 模擬器,它便會要求你給一個檔案夾來開啓,這時候你選擇剛剛我們說的那個 HelloWorld 資料夾,就可以看到模擬器在你的電腦螢幕上跑出一支 iPhone,然後裡面有一個地球,上面寫著 Hello World 的文字。

很簡單吧!試著開幾個不同的 Project 來看看 Corona SDK 有哪些強大的功能。下一次我再來講上面提到的那三個檔案是什麼用途。

待續...


2 則留言:

  1. 請問在登錄Corona SDK出現(Could not connect to server. Please check you Internet connection )要如何處理

    回覆刪除
  2. 我的經驗是有時後官網伺服器會連不上,尤其你常換地方上網,過一會再試可能就會可以了吧。

    回覆刪除